ABA therapy plays a crucial role in helping children with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) engage with their communities and develop social skills. By focusing on individualized strategies and positive reinforcement, ABA therapy can make a significant impact on a child's ability to interact with others and participate in community activities.
Importance of Community Involvement Community involvement is essential for children with autism as it provides opportunities for socialization, learning, and growth. Engaging in community activities helps children develop a sense of belonging and fosters positive relationships.
Strategies for Encouraging Social Interactions ABA therapists use a variety of strategies to encourage social interactions, including:
Role-Playing and Social Stories: These techniques help children understand and practice appropriate social behaviors in a controlled setting.
Positive Reinforcement: Rewarding positive social interactions helps reinforce desired behaviors.
Structured Playdates and Group Activities: Organizing playdates and group activities provides children with opportunities to practice social skills in a natural environment.
